Tuning Legged Locomotion Controllers via Safe Bayesian Optimization

06/12/2023
by   Daniel Widmer, et al.
ETH Zurich
0

In this paper, we present a data-driven strategy to simplify the deployment of model-based controllers in legged robotic hardware platforms. Our approach leverages a model-free safe learning algorithm to automate the tuning of control gains, addressing the mismatch between the simplified model used in the control formulation and the real system. This method substantially mitigates the risk of hazardous interactions with the robot by sample-efficiently optimizing parameters within a probably safe region. Additionally, we extend the applicability of our approach to incorporate the different gait parameters as contexts, leading to a safe, sample-efficient exploration algorithm capable of tuning a motion controller for diverse gait patterns. We validate our method through simulation and hardware experiments, where we demonstrate that the algorithm obtains superior performance on tuning a model-based motion controller for multiple gaits safely.

READ FULL TEXT
01/19/2021

Safe and Efficient Model-free Adaptive Control via Bayesian Optimization

Adaptive control approaches yield high-performance controllers when a pr...
05/07/2018

Using Simulation to Improve Sample-Efficiency of Bayesian Optimization for Bipedal Robots

Learning for control can acquire controllers for novel robotic tasks, pa...
04/16/2019

Energy-Efficient Slithering Gait Exploration for a Snake-like Robot based on Reinforcement Learning

Similar to their counterparts in nature, the flexible bodies of snake-li...
09/27/2021

Model-based Motion Imitation for Agile, Diverse and Generalizable Quadupedal Locomotion

Robots operating in human environments need a variety of skills, like sl...
11/15/2019

Safe Interactive Model-Based Learning

Control applications present hard operational constraints. A violation o...
03/08/2017

Model-Based Policy Search for Automatic Tuning of Multivariate PID Controllers

PID control architectures are widely used in industrial applications. De...
08/23/2018

Decentralized Control of a Hexapod Robot Using a Wireless Time Synchronized Network

Robots and control systems rely upon precise timing of sensors and actua...

Please sign up or login with your details

Forgot password? Click here to reset